Bring your brightest version of you and have a brighter work day here.About the TeamThe newly formed Field Engagement & Planning team is a pillar within Global Sales Enablement (GSE) responsible for owning and managing GSE’s relationships with field sales globally.About the RoleThe Director of Field Engagement and Planning will lead a team of Engagement Managers and Sales Training leads dedicated to North America and Specialized, while focusing individually on managing the relationship with Large Enterprise in North America.   Responsibilities include leading a team that:Provides consistent voice of the field input to GSE initiatives, practices, and processesEstablishes trusted partnerships with Sales Leadership, Sales Strategy & Operations Leaders, and key support teamsPartners across GSE and Revenue Operations to secure leadership sponsorship and field input for global program strategy and executionDevelops and socializes enablement roadmaps that include global programs, GTM, and segment specific prioritiesExecutes and delivers global and segment specific training, coaching, and development programsHas an awareness of all enablement efforts happening in-region or by segmentAbout YouBasic Qualifications12+ years of relative work experience in a Sales, Sales Support or Presales role is required, preferably aligned to a Large Enterprise environment5+ years of experience successfully leading teams with direct and dotted reporting linesOther QualificationsAbility to establish and develop trust with Workday executive sponsors and communicate regularly with senior sales leaders Experience working cross-functionally and collaboratively across pre-sales, sales, services, marketing, product, etc. to align on and drive projects to completionAbility to deliver results with minimal guidance and short turnaround timesStrong people leader with excellent level of interpersonal skillsWorkday Pay Transparency Statement - United States The annualized base salary ranges for the primary location and any additional locations in the United States (US) are listed below.  Workday pay ranges vary based on work location. For more information regarding Workday’s comprehensive benefits, please click here. Primary Location: USA.CA.Pleasanton Primary Location Base Pay Range: $200,700 - $301,200 Additional US Location(s) Base Pay Range: $178,300 - $301,200Our Approach to Flexible Work With Flex Work, we’re combining the best of both worlds: in-person time and remote. Our approach enables our teams to deepen connections, maintain a strong community, and do their best work. We know that flexibility can take shape in many ways, so rather than a number of required days in-office each week, we simply spend at least half (50%) of our time each quarter in the office or in the field with our customers, prospects, and partners (depending on role). This means you'll have the freedom to create a flexible schedule that caters to your business, team, and personal needs, while being intentional to make the most of time spent together.
